Olivia Gadecki is an Australian professional tennis player steadily making a name for herself on the WTA tour. Born on April 24, 2002, Gadecki is from the Gold Coast, Queensland, and represents a new wave of Australian talent looking to break into the upper echelons of the sport.
Gadecki’s journey in tennis began at a young age, showing early promise and dedication. Her game is characterized by a powerful serve and aggressive baseline play. She favors a forehand that she can rip cross-court or down the line, putting pressure on her opponents to defend from the outset. Coupled with a developing backhand and a willingness to approach the net, she possesses the tools necessary to compete at the highest level.
Her breakthrough moment arrived in 2021 at the Gippsland Trophy, a WTA 500 event held in Melbourne ahead of the Australian Open. Granted a wildcard into the main draw, Gadecki caused a major upset by defeating the then-reigning Australian Open champion and world number four, Sofia Kenin. This victory immediately placed her on the radar of tennis fans and analysts alike, highlighting her potential to challenge established players.
